Matthias Clesle is "one of the leading experts in leadership development in Germany" (Forbes) – and anyone who has seen him in person knows exactly why. He does away with outdated seminar classics and instead offers solutions that work in everyday life.
With over 21 years of experience as a multi-award-winning speaker and trainer, member of the Forbes Coaching Council, and university lecturer, he knows the stumbling blocks managers face. In more than 200 engagements per year, he shows them how to lead "without mercy, but with kindness" – with natural authority and human sensitivity.
Whether on the big stage, in front of the camera, or in the seminar room: Matthias Clesle delivers visible results. Those who book him won't get a lukewarm event, but an energetic upgrade full of practical methods, concrete results, and a touch of provocation – always accompanied by a good mood.

Annual employee reviews often focus on setting goals, but this can be counterproductive. Instead, addressing problems in these reviews can lead to increased motivation, better relationships, and more effective solutions. This approach fosters trust, communication, and employee engagement, ultimately benefiting both employees and the company. Regular follow-ups are recommended to address issues promptly and effectively.
